Abstract
Η εφεύρεση αναφέρεται σε ηλεκτροπαραγωγικό σταθμό με ηλιακή καμινάδα που ονομάστηκε περίκλειστος από τον τρόπο κατασκευής του ηλιακού του συλλέκτη. Ο ηλιακός συλλέκτης του περίκλειστου σταθμού (1.1)φέρει διαφανή οροφή (1.2) και περιβάλλεται από περιφερειακό κατακόρυφο στεγανό τοίχωμα (1.3). Το περιφερειακό κατακόρυφο τοίχωμα φέρει ανοίγματα (1.4), από τα οποία μπορεί αποκλειστικά να εισέλθει τορεύμα του αέρα, το οποίο αναπληρώνει την ποσότητα θερμού αέρα που διαφεύγει συνεχώς προς την ατμόσφαιρα διά της ηλιακής καμινάδας. Το εισερχόμενο ρεύμα του αέρα σε κάθε άνοιγμα (1.4) περιστρέφει τον αντίστοιχο αεροστρόβιλο (2.1) και ο οποίος περιστρέφει την ηλεκτρογεννήτρια (2.2) με την οποία είναι απευθείας συνδεδεμένος, παράγοντας τελικά ηλεκτρισμό. Σε κάθε άνοιγμα (1.4) υπάρχει ένα ηλεκτρομηχανικό σύστημα φραγής (2.3), το οποίο μπορεί να ανοίγει ή να φράζει το άνοιγμα επιτρέποντας ή εμποδίζοντας τον αέρα να εισέλθει σε αυτό, ενώ συγχρόνως μπορεί να συνδέει ή να αποσυνδέει την ηλεκτρογεννήτρια (2.2) στο ηλεκτρικό δίκτυο.
